This specimen was lot 46123 in Stack's Bowers ANA sale (Chicago, August 2024), where it sold for $384. The catalog description[1] noted, "GERMANY. Saxony. Taler, 1620-HvR. Dresden Mint. Johann Georg I. NGC AU-50." This type was struck 1620-38 and is fairly common. A very similar thaler, Dav-7591, with the obverse legend ending "CLIV:ETMONT:", was also struck in 1620. We don't see the "HvR" mintmaster's initials listed in the SCWC for this date.
Recorded mintage: unknown.
Specification: silver.
Catalog reference: Dav-7601; KM-132.
